Preparation time: 20 minutes
Cooking time: 10 minutes
Total time: 30 minutes
Number of servings: 4

Ingredients:
- 150g Galbani Mascarpone (or any other quality mascarpone cheese)
- 150g vanilla cream (you can use a ready-made cream or make it at home)
- 80g sugar
- 4 apples, preferably sweet and aromatic varieties (Granny Smith apples are excellent for a flavor contrast)
- 100g amaretti cookies (or any other type of cookies you prefer)
- 1/2 cup of white wine (sweet wine will add a deep flavor)
- Cinnamon (to taste)
- Cocoa (for decoration)
Step by step for a perfect result:
1. Preparing the apples
Start by washing the apples well. Peel them and slice them thinly. In a medium saucepan, add the apple slices, 30g of sugar, 1/2 cup of white wine, and a pinch of cinnamon. Bring the mixture to a boil over medium heat and let it simmer for 5-7 minutes until the apples become slightly soft and caramelized.
2. Preparing the mascarpone cream
In a bowl, combine the mascarpone cheese with the remaining sugar (50g) and the vanilla cream. Use a hand mixer or spatula to mix the ingredients well until you achieve a smooth and fluffy cream. If desired, you can also add a splash of vanilla extract for extra flavor.
3. Crumbling the cookies
In a sealed bag or bowl, crumble the amaretti cookies using a rolling pin or your hands until you obtain fine crumbs. These will add a crunchy texture to your dessert.
4. Assembling the dessert
Start assembling the dessert in individual cups or bowls. Place a thin layer of cookie crumbs at the bottom of each cup, followed by a layer of caramelized apples. Then, add a generous layer of mascarpone cream over the apples. Repeat these layers until you finish the ingredients, ensuring that the last layer is cream.
5. Decorating the dessert
For an attractive appearance, decorate each serving with a few apple slices and sprinkle cocoa on top. The bitter aroma of cocoa will contrast perfectly with the sweetness of the apples and the creaminess of the mascarpone.
6. Cooling and serving
It is recommended to let the dessert sit in the refrigerator for 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ld. Serve the dessert from individual molds, enjoying every bite.
Useful tips:
- If you want to add a touch of freshness, you can add a few fresh mint leaves on top.
- You can experiment with different types of cookies; digestive biscuits or even chocolate cookies can add an interesting flavor.
- For a healthier version, you can reduce the amount of sugar or use natural sweeteners.

Frequently asked questions:
- Can I use other types of fruits? Absolutely! Peaches or pears are excellent in combination with mascarpone.
- Is this dessert suitable for vegans? You can replace mascarpone with a vegan alternative and the vanilla cream with a plant-based alternative.
